캐싱의 원리와 목적

캐싱(Caching)

Untitled

캐시의 적용

Untitled

Ex. 웹 브라우저에서 이미지, 자바스크립트 소스 등을 캐시해둠

캐싱 관련 개념들

캐싱 전략

  1. Cache-Aside(Lazy Loading)

    1. 항상 캐시를 먼저 체크하고, 없으면 원본(ex: DB)에서 읽어온 후에 캐시에 저장함
    2. 장점: 필요한 데이터만 캐시에 저장되고, Cache Miss가 있어도 치명적이지 않음 (원본 읽으면 되니까)
    3. 단점: 최초 접근은 느림, 업데이트 주기가 일정하지 않기 때문에 캐시가 최신 데이터가 아닐 수 있음

    Untitled